  5. Combat and stat bonus for melee combat is definatly dual sabers/dual blades, especially since force speed doesnt even give +def anymore, making it less useful. On the other hand, if all you want to do is spam force powers go for single saber. The +3 def isnt bad and the +attack will help a weaker character score hits.

  9. from the post from the developer before the game was released, T3 was supposed to handle item upgrade half of the workbench, while Bao-Dur was going to handle the creation/breakdown half of the workbench, similar to how the disciple handles the creation/breakdown of drugs. I'm not sure if it was cut, or if my Bao-Dur just wants to be the annoying type. He tends to hand out shields only sporadically (even when i have few) and rarely wants to talk at all.
